      Re: M5Stack Core 2 appears to be bricked

      Hi all, I think that I've really bricked my Core2. I tried to install a program from M5Burner upon initial power up of my brand new Core2. When that didn't work I tried going back to Core2FactoryTest, but now I'm not getting that to work. When I connect to the Serial Monitor, I see this error:

      [FROM M5Burner] COM5 opened.
      Guru Meditation Error: Core 0 panic'ed (StoreProhibited). Exception was unhandled.

      Core 0 register dump:
      PC : 0x4011db0c PS : 0x00060430 A0 : 0x800e5936 A1 : 0x3ffbce90
      A2 : 0x00000080 A3 : 0xaaaacc62 A4 : 0x00400000 A5 : 0x3f800000
      A6 : 0x00000001 A7 : 0x00000001 A8 : 0x000066c8 A9 : 0x000066d0
      A10 : 0x00100000 A11 : 0xaaaaaaaa A12 : 0x00000000 A13 : 0x000056d0
      A14 : 0x3ff12000 A15 : 0x00000000 SAR : 0x0000000f EXCCAUSE: 0x0000001d
      EXCVADDR: 0x000066d0 LBEG : 0x4011df50 LEND : 0x4011df59 LCOUNT : 0x00000000

      Backtrace:0x4011db09:0x3ffbce900x400e5933:0x3ffbceb0 0x400e5885:0x3ffbced0 0x400e790e:0x3ffbcef0 0x40177fed:0x3ffbcf20

      ELF file SHA256: 0000000000000000

      Rebooting...

      Any thoughts?

      Thanks, Brian
